Here’s the breakdown: • “A” is pronounced as it would be in the English word “Father.”, • “E” is pronounced as it would be in the English word “Get.”, • “I” is pronounced as it would be in the English word “Ski.”, • “O” is pronounced as it would be in the English word “Soap.”, • “U” is pronounced as it would be in the English word “Flu.”. Here’s a breakdown of those: • “LY” is pronounced as they would be in the English phrase “Will ye?”, • “NH” is pronounced as they would be in the English word “Lasagna.”. ", The diphthong "oi" sounds like the "oy" in the English word "toy. ", The diphthong "ei" sounds like the "ay" in the English word "day. ", An open "o" sounds similar to the short "o" sound in the English word "pot. ", An open "e" makes an "eh" sound, similar to the "e" in the English word "pet.
